ایجاد سوال
dark_mode
0 دوستدار 0 امتیاز منفی
13 visibility
موضوع: آفیس توسط:

فرانک از یک ماکرو برای ایجاد یک گزارش شخصی در اکسل استفاده می کند. سپس ماکرو هر گزارش شخصی شده را به عنوان یک فایل PDF ذخیره می کند. این با موفقیت 350 فایل PDF تولید می کند. سپس ماکرو از Outlook برای ارسال ایمیل آن گزارش ها، یکی یکی استفاده می کند. ماکرو همیشه بعد از گزارش 95، هر بار متوقف می شود. اگر فرانک کد را طوری تغییر دهد که به جای فایل PDF یک فایل XLSX را ایمیل کند، آنگاه همه 350 را بدون مشکل ارسال می کند. او به دنبال ایده هایی برای این است که چرا ایمیل کردن 350 پیام، همراه با پیوست PDF، پس از 95 پیام به طور مداوم با بریک مواجه می شود.

همانطور که در مورد بسیاری از ماکروها وجود دارد، بدون نگاه کردن به کد و داده های دستکاری شده، ارائه گسترده ترین طیف پیشنهادات دشوار است. با این حال، چند چیز وجود دارد که می توانید به آنها نگاه کنید.

اول، گزارش هایی وجود دارد که نشان می دهد در صورتی که ماکرو شما کپی و چسباندن زیادی انجام می دهد، سابقه کلیپ بورد می تواند مشکلاتی ایجاد کند. بنابراین، قبل از اجرای ماکرو، تاریخچه کلیپ بورد را غیرفعال کنید.

دوم، این واقعیت که هر بار در یک نقطه متوقف می شود، به نظر می رسد نشان دهنده این است که چیزی در آن نقطه وجود دارد که باعث این موضوع شده است. به فایل های پی دی اف 94 و 95 (بله هر دو) نگاهی بیندازید و حجم آنها را ببینید. این امکان وجود دارد که یک یا هر دو از اندازه پیوست های مجاز Outlook یا ISP شما بیشتر باشد. می توانید با انتقال آن گیرندگان به موقعیت بعدی در ترتیب پردازش و دیدن اینکه آیا مشکل شما به همان نقطه ای که آنها را به آن منتقل کرده اید منتقل می شود، این موضوع را به سرعت تعیین کنید.

در نهایت، اگر پیوست های فردی به اندازه کافی کوچک باشند، ممکن است در مجموع بیش از حد بزرگ باشند. شرط خوبی است که فایل های PDF بزرگتر از فایل های XLSX باشند. از آنجایی که فایل های بزرگ تری را پیوست می کنید و آنها را ایمیل می کنید، ممکن است ماکرو شما سعی کند پیام ها را سریع تر از ارسال پیام ها توسط Outlook یا پذیرفته شدن توسط ISP شما منتقل کند. سعی کنید بعد از هر 50 پیام یا بیشتر، یک تأخیر – شاید حتی دو دقیقه – قرار دهید. ممکن است قبل از ارسال رزومه، گلوگاه برطرف شود. اگر کار کرد، می توانید تاخیر را طوری پخش کنید که یکنواخت تر شود. به عنوان مثال، می توانید پس از ارسال هر پیام، سه ثانیه تأخیر یا پس از هر ده پیام، تأخیر بیست و دومی قرار دهید. این به آزمایش نیاز دارد، اما ممکن است مشکل را کاهش دهد.

اگر خواستی، با این لینک از ما حمایت کن

پاسخ شما

looks_5نام شما برای نمایش - اختیاری
حریم شخصی : آدرس ایمیل شما محفوظ میماند و برای استفاده های تجاری و تبلیغاتی به کار نمی رود
عدد چهار رقمی در تصویر را وارد کنید

برای جلوگیری از این تایید در آینده, لطفا وارد شده یا ثبت نام کنید.
اگر حساب گوگل دارید به راحتی وارید شوید

0 پاسخ وجود دارد

سوال مشابهی یافت نشد

برای دسترسی راحت به مطالب سایت ، اپلیکیشن سایت را نصب کنید
و لطفا بعد از نصب امتیاز دهید. با تشکر از حمایت شما

23.2k سوال

8.5k پاسخ

608 دیدگاه

9.7k کاربر

85 نفر آنلاین
0 عضو و 85 مهمان در سایت حاضرند
بازدید امروز: 10658
بازدید دیروز: 23384
بازدید کل: 15261558
...